“Revolutionizing the Skies: Leonardo and Baykar Unite for Advanced Unmanned Technologies”

A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) was finalized today between Baykar Technologies and Leonardo for the advancement of unmanned technologies.

The accord is founded on the industrial synergies and complementary strengths of the two firms within the unmanned domain. The Joint Venture, headquartered in Italy, encompasses the design, development, manufacturing, and upkeep of unmanned aerial systems.

This collaboration will utilize Baykar’s industry-leading unmanned platforms, known for their operational efficiency across diverse global markets, alongside Leonardo’s specialization in mission systems, payload configuration, and relevant aerospace certification in Europe. The European market for the upcoming decade, which includes unmanned combat aircraft, armed reconnaissance drones, and deep-strike UAVs, is anticipated to attain $100 billion.

Both organizations, actively involved in the creation and production of UAVs, electronic systems, payloads, C4I (Command, Control, Communications, Computers, and Intelligence), Artificial Intelligence, integrated mission systems, space technology, and services, will guarantee seamless interoperability within multi-domain environments.

Through this partnership, Leonardo and Baykar aim to collaboratively explore opportunities in both European and international markets, while also leveraging additional synergies within the space sector.

The Leonardo facilities engaged in the initiatives developed by the Joint Venture will be those in Ronchi dei Legionari (Friuli), a specialist hub in the unmanned sector; Torino (Piedmont) and Roma Tiburtina, focusing on production elements and the advancement of integrated multi-domain technologies; and Nerviano (Lombardy) for the co-created solutions offered for the space domain.
